Matthew Galetto is the Founder and CEO of MediRecords. Matthew has a B.Sc. (Hons) degree from James Cook University. He has worked in IT executive roles in the healthcare, banking & hospitality industries both in the UK and Australia for businesses such as Westpac, Barclays, Royal Bank of Scotland, Rabobank, Accor.
Matthew has over twenty years of experience in health technology, having previously been the Principal Technical Architect of a leading practice management solution.
Matthew also founded AsteRx prior to MediRecords, a clinical data analytics company that reported insights into the use & behaviour of GP practice management systems.
Our Chief Product Officer, Jayne Thompson, leads the MediRecords product team with over 12 years of experience in digital health products across the Pharmacy, Hospital, Virtual Care and Primary Care segments.
With a Bachelor degree in Business and Technology, Jayne is passionate about innovation in technology and how it can improve business efficiencies, clinical safety and patient outcomes within the healthcare sector.
As CFO, Mohan Alagarsamy leads the finance function at MediRecords. Having more than twenty years of experience in banking and private equity with exposure to health care and technology companies, Mohan focuses on the financial management, commercial and compliance risk management, taxation, investor relations, and M&A activities of the business.
Mohan holds a Bachelor of Accounting & Finance (1st Class Honours) and an Executive MBA, specialising in Business and Managerial Economics from the University of Technology Sydney. He is also a member of Chartered Accountants – Australia & New Zealand and Taxation Institute of Australia.

Shanthy leads MediRecords’ Customer Success, Onboarding, Security & Compliance, Support, and Business Operations teams. With over 20 years of experience across banking, consulting, and digital transformation, she brings deep expertise in driving strategic outcomes within regulated industries.
A graduate with a Bachelor’s degree in Applied Finance, Shanthy is a seasoned leader known for shaping and executing customer-centric strategies. Her career has spanned both large enterprises and fast-paced startup, where she has built and led high-performing teams across functions including User Experience Design, Customer Success, Change Management, Delivery, and Implementation. Shanthy’s passion lies in delivering seamless customer experiences and driving operational excellence through innovation and collaboration.
Jake brings over 20 years of experience in SaaS sales, customer engagement, strategic partnerships and value-based growth; with a significant portion of his career spent at Healthengine, Australia’s leading consumer healthcare platform. Here, he held senior roles including VP of Enterprise Sales & Strategic Partnerships, working extensively to drive digital bookings, patient engagement, practice growth and operational efficiencies.
Jake’s customer-centric approach, collaborative leadership, and proven track record in navigating complex healthcare workflows make him a valued partner for providers embracing digital transformation.
Outside of work, Jake is also committed to community impact, having founded fundraising initiatives and supported youth mental health programs.

Dr Cooke has held a public position as Director of Orthopaedics at the Princess Alexandra Hospital since January 2004.
He is a Specialist Lower Limb Orthopaedic Surgeon with an interest in Adult Hip and Knee Replacements, Sports Knee Surgery and Lower Limb Trauma.
Dr Cooke gained his Medical Degree from the University of Queensland in 1992 and his Orthopaedic Fellowship in 2001. Dr Cooke subsequently held a number of positions in his area of special interest with training at the Mater Private Hospital Sydney with Dr Bill Walter in Hip and Knee Reconstruction; at the University of British Columbia with the Vancouver General Hospital in Orthopaedic Trauma; and at the University of Sheffield with Dr Ian Stockley concentrating on complex Hip and Knee Reconstructive Surgery.
Dr Cooke is a member of the Medico Legal Society of Queensland and became a Certified Independent Medical Examiner (American Board of Independent Examiners), 2004. He has completed the Comcare Permanent Impairment Guide Training.

Dr Jayarajan has over 15 years of experience as a doctor, with 4 years working in both public and private hospitals throughout Australia and 11 years working in general practice in Melbourne. He has broad experience, knowledge and insight into the healthcare services sector, with strengths in strategic thinking, long-term planning and risk management.
His clinical interests include aged care, dementia, palliative care, chronic and complex disease management and mental health. He also has special interests in standardisation and consistency of clinical care using clinical decision support technology as well as the applications of artificial intelligence in primary care.
He is an experienced advisor and investor in the healthcare services sector, with further interests in ASX-listed company corporate governance, executive remuneration structures and capital management.
